WebCity of Ten Thousand Buddhas is one of the first Chinese Zen Buddhist temples in the United States, and it is one of the largest Buddhist communities in the Western Hemisphere. Originally the site housed the Mendocino State Hospital. The Dharma Realm Buddhist Association purchased the City of Ten Thousand Buddhas site in 1974. Web16. jan 2024 · 1. Daegaksa Temple. Daegaksa (or Daegagsa) is a small temple dating to the Japanese colonial era in Korea (1910-1945). It is located is the middle of Gwangbok-dong, a very busy and fashionable neighborhood. The temple is sandwiched between Gukje Market, the largest traditional market in all of South Korea, and Yongdusan Park, where Busan …

Web4. jan 2024 · Updated on January 04, 2024. Offering food is one of the oldest and most common rituals of Buddhism. Food is given to monks during alms rounds and also ritually offered to tantric deities and hungry ghosts.
